From 9b03ad3f309fde5fa32f480a425239cd056e96f0 2011-10-23 16:25:33 From: HanzZ Date: 2011-10-23 16:25:33 Subject: [PATCH] test --- diff --git a/src/tests/usermanager.cpp b/src/tests/usermanager.cpp index d0084ddfd8554bf98662639eb31247ee70e575e5..428892c707990f8d39c348147ad4dc7fc49ac279 100644 --- a/src/tests/usermanager.cpp +++ b/src/tests/usermanager.cpp @@ -169,7 +169,10 @@ class UserManagerTest : public CPPUNIT_NS :: TestFixture, public Swift::XMPPPars CPPUNIT_ASSERT_EQUAL(2, (int) received.size()); CPPUNIT_ASSERT(getStanza(received[0])->getPayload()); - CPPUNIT_ASSERT(dynamic_cast(getStanza(received[1]))); + + Swift::Presence *presence = dynamic_cast(getStanza(received[1])); + CPPUNIT_ASSERT(presence); + CPPUNIT_ASSERT_EQUAL(Swift::Presence::Unavailable, presence->getType()); } Swift::Stanza *getStanza(boost::shared_ptr element) {